The most commonly-asked question by landowners regarding solar farms is, How much can I lease my land for? The short answer is, “it depends,” but solar lease rates (also called “rents”) typically range from about $450 to $2,500 per acre, per year—though can go much, much higher. This article looks. . Why do greenhouse plants need supplementary lighting?
Because of the foggy days, especially when the plants are growing at germination stage, they need adequate light illumination to finish their growth [1, 2]. Therefore, in order to increase their production, supplementary lighting illumination is essential for greenhouse plants [, , ].
How 3D supplementary lighting can be achieved?
Approaching this way, 3D supplementary lighting can be achieved. Namely, during the plants growth, its every leaf can be illuminated between the lines of plants by the device. The 3D supplementary lighting is designed by LED lamps and shown in Fig. 3. A certain absorption wavelength can also be selected to illuminate the plant for its growing.
Can sunlight-led supplementary illumination work with multi-layers frame greenhouse plants?
Combining the advantages of sunlight and LED for the greenhouse plants, an intelligent sunlight-LED supplementary illumination system with multi-layers frame greenhouse plants has been proposed in our group.
Can intelligent supplementary illumination be used for greenhouse plants?
This paper was aimed at coming up with a system that's used for the greenhouse plants with intelligent supplementary illumination, which can supply light to every leaf with a hybrid sunlight-LED (light-emitting diode) based on the Internet of Things (IOT).
